Connecting dots behind the real connection of this metaphor

Observers call AI minister Diella of Albania set to deliver 83 children a clever way to roll out massive software deployment

There are many who are questioning what was truly happening behind this unusual pregnancy narrative. The announcement that came from Minister Edi Rama is the launch of 82 new AI assistants. Each of the digital “children” will remain assigned to a member of the ruling Socialist party. This will fundamentally change how parliamentary work gets recorded as well as conducted.

The AI systems have been designed to act as virtual aids for MPs. The primary function of these systems would be attending parliamentary sessions. It will thoroughly keep a record of all the proceedings and offer suggestions to members.

As explained by the Prime Minister, AI children will have “knowledge of their mother,” Diella. They will be leveraging the same core tech. It will be a direct integration of the AI into the legislative process, aimed at enhancing efficiency as well as oversight by the year 2026.

The initiative presents a drop in AI testing in high-level government functions. The project would push boundaries of how the tech could be woven in political administration fabric, moving beyond some simple chatbots, to active participants within governance.
